Zhang Xiaoji was a scholar in Xuchang of the Song Dynasty. After he grew up, a rich gentleman in his village liked his talent and married his daughter to him. The rich man had only one son, a playboy look, all day long, roaming the streets of the countryside, play and play, very bad. One day, the rich man saw him all day wander, is really unworthy, in a rage, the son thrown out of the house, and he broke off the relationship between father and son.

Later, the rich man got a serious illness. He saw that his son-in-law, Hsiao-ki, was a generous and loving man, and before he died, he gave all his property to him. Hyoji buried his father-in-law properly like his own son. He followed his father-in-law’s instructions and managed the house in a well organized manner.

After the rich Family‘s son was kicked out of the house, he became a beggar in the countryside and had to beg for a living because he could not support himself. One day, he was begging, just happened to run into Zhang Xiaoji. At that Time, the beggar did not know xiaoji; xiaoji recognized him. If it is a normal person, completely can pretend not to know, quietly leave, and will not be criticized. But hyoji did not do that.

When Hsiao-ki saw him so down and out, he was so upset that he asked him, “Can you water the garden?” The rich man’s son said, “If I can water the garden and make a living, that’s fine.” Hyoji let him water the vegetable garden. He did well in this small task, and gradually got rid of his poor appearance and was able to earn his own living.

When Hyoji saw the change in him, he was also surprised and asked him again, “Can you manage the warehouse?” He said, “I am already satisfied that you let me water the garden, but now you let me manage the warehouse, and if I can really do that, I will be very lucky.” So the rich man’s son took over the job of managing the warehouse and acted in a very careful and disciplined way without any mistakes.

After observing him carefully for a period of time, and knowing that he was able to reform himself and not to commit the same mistakes of eating, drinking, and playing, he returned to his son all the property that his father-in-law had given him back then.

Although Hyoji legally inherited his father-in-law’s family fortune, he wholeheartedly helped his father-in-law’s son reform when he was down and out so that he would be able to inherit his father’s business, and returned all of his father-in-law’s family fortune to him without embezzling his father-in-law’s family fortune.
